summaryrefslogtreecommitdiff
path: root/xml
diff options
context:
space:
mode:
authorVille Skyttä <ville.skytta@iki.fi>2011-11-05 23:18:26 +0200
committerVille Skyttä <ville.skytta@iki.fi>2011-11-05 23:18:26 +0200
commit275959c64eaf91c088f426ea451ab14fab31c098 (patch)
tree032c00d4d4c45d17acdbdfedeaaa35f2a0a9e93c /xml
parentda936332dc117580a0f6a04aa17525e1c31b77d9 (diff)
downloadvdr-plugin-text2skin-275959c64eaf91c088f426ea451ab14fab31c098.tar.gz
vdr-plugin-text2skin-275959c64eaf91c088f426ea451ab14fab31c098.tar.bz2
Use empty() instead of size() to check container emptiness.
Diffstat (limited to 'xml')
-rw-r--r--xml/parser.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/xml/parser.c b/xml/parser.c
index bbfd09b..8329fb6 100644
--- a/xml/parser.c
+++ b/xml/parser.c
@@ -87,7 +87,7 @@ static uint oindex = 0;
bool xStartElem(const std::string &name, std::map<std::string,std::string> &attrs) {
//Dprintf("start element: %s\n", name.c_str());
- if (context.size() == 0) {
+ if (context.empty()) {
if (name == "skin") {
ATTRIB_MAN_FUNC ("version", skin->mVersion.Parse);
ATTRIB_MAN_STRING("name", skin->mTitle);
@@ -128,7 +128,7 @@ bool xStartElem(const std::string &name, std::map<std::string,std::string> &attr
else {
object = new cxObject(display);
if (object->ParseType(name)) {
- if (parents.size() > 0)
+ if (!parents.empty())
object->mRefresh = parents.back()->mRefresh;
else
object->mRefresh = display->mRefreshDefault;
@@ -246,7 +246,7 @@ bool xEndElem(const std::string &name) {
display = NULL;
oindex = 0;
}
- else if (object != NULL || parents.size() > 0) {
+ else if (object != NULL || !parents.empty()) {
if (object == NULL) {
Dprintf("rotating parent to object\n");
object = parents[parents.size() - 1];
@@ -282,7 +282,7 @@ bool xEndElem(const std::string &name) {
}
object->mIndex = oindex++;
- if (parents.size() > 0) {
+ if (!parents.empty()) {
Dprintf("pushing to parent\n");
cxObject *parent = parents[parents.size() - 1];
if (parent->mObjects == NULL)